March 16, 2011 - Garrison Keillor says he's retiring. In an interview with AARP published on their website earlier today, Keillor said he plans to step down from hosting A Prairie Home Companion in the spring of 2013.

September 11, 2009 - When you think of a Coen brothers movie you might think of murder or dark humor. Religion columnist Cathleen Falsani thinks there are deep moral truths embedded in most of Joel and Ethan Coen's work, including the films "Blood Simple", "Fargo" and "The Big Lebowski."
